Example 10.6 An embankment is to be formed with its centre line on the surface (in the form of a plane) on full dip of 1 in 20. If the formation width is 40 ft and formation height are 10, 15, and 20 ft at intervals of 100 feet, with the side slopes 1 in 2, calculate the volume between the end sections.
